May 2025 - Apr 2026Annesley Walk area has the 2nd highest crime rate of 43 local areas in Junction , and the 5th highest crime rate of 506 local areas in Islington .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Annesley Walk (N19 5DR) in the last 12 months was 1776.1 per 1,000 residents and was 546.3% higher than the Junction average (274.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 395 offences recorded. The least common crime was Possession of weapons with 2 cases ,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Possession of weapons 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Bicycle theft ( -40.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 472 (≈ 1201.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 1.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 10.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Annesley Walk (N19 5DR), the main crime hotspot is near Hospital. Police recorded 528 crimes here, including 406 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
